Operating instructions:

  1. Mobile phone charging area: Place your mobile phone vertically in the mobile phone wireless charging area and the charging indicator on the display of your mobile phone lighting up, showing that your mobile phone is charging.

  2. Charging the watch: Put the watch on the wireless charging area, and align the magnets; the “Charging indicator” on the watch will light up, indicating that it is being charged properly.

  1. The product uses a 12V-3A DC port adapter for power supply and is connected to the DC port of the product. If the base indicator blinks three times and then off, it indicates that the power supply is connected.
  2. Mobile phone wireless charging indicator: The blue indicator is always on while the phone is being charged. The blue indicator light is off when the phone is not charged. When the charging abnormal or fault, the indicator will blink.

Attention

  1. Do not use a case that is more than 5mm thick or with metal in it when charging your device
  2. Do not place metal foreign bodies in the charging area
  3. When charging, please align the device with the center of the charging area
